Output 64d8badc65c9264504fd1f94f2107b4dd959cff7f898840334bcab5e4b464453:2

value
9885951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7691840ceecc9301741a251320446c4548b0578d OP_EQUAL
address
MJi6HgZ5EdYfrDvyzbU3ucGmuLJE9vYoHE
transaction
64d8badc65c9264504fd1f94f2107b4dd959cff7f898840334bcab5e4b464453
spent
true